The dormant Team Black bats came to life with a bang in Guilford World Series Game 5 Wednesday. After mustering an attack that included only two runs over the first four games of the series, Team Black exploded for three runs on a single, two doubles and a triple in the bottom of the sixth off Cardinal starter and loser Anthony Ramakis to salvage the game and keep hopes alive in the series, which now stands at 3-2 in favor of Team Cardinal.

Ramakis had been cruising, allowing one run on five singles through five innings, but seemed to unravel after a one-out line drive by KC Chambers found its way between outfielders all the way to the fence for a triple. Andy Reed followed with his second RBI single of the game cutting the Cardinal lead to 3-2. After John Ludington struck out, back to back doubles by Joe Dooley and Jason Wynn gave Team Black their first last-inning lead since Game one.

Jeff Joyce, who entered the game in the sixth in relief of starter Joe Dooley and gave up what seemed to be a decisive third run, worked a perfect seventh to pick up his first victory of the series.

Team Cardinal continued to swing hot bats, garnering seven hits in the game, but Dooley and Joyce managed to spread them thin enough to facilitate the 4-3 final score. If Team Black had needed an offensive spark, they got it from Chambers and Reed, who were a combined 5 for 6 with two runs scored and two RBI on the day. Reed's three hits are a fall classic high, and Chambers' triple is one of only three hits for more than two bases in the series.

 

Notes: Eric Pelletier's hitting streak ended at three with an 0 for 2 day at the plate.... Team Cardinal's Steve Danis sprained his ankle in the first inning, and is likely out for the remainder of the series... Ramakis was a leading candidate for MVP until the Team Black sixth inning... Team Black's three runs in the sixth equalled their total for the previous 32 innings.... Both teams played well defensively, and, for the first time, all runs scored in the game were earned.. Joyce and Pelletier made the first two relief appearances of the series as both managers have been reluctant to go to the pen.
